Charles Hadden, a cherished husband, father, brother, and friend, passed away on September 27, 2025, at the age of 73 in Marianna, Florida. Born on July 27, 1952, in Daytona Beach, Florida, Charles lived a life dedicated to his family and his work as a truck driver, a career he devoted many years to with great pride.
Known for his loving nature, Charles was a good man and a true family man. He was often described as a workaholic, putting his heart and soul into everything he did. His commitment to his family and work was evident in the way he balanced his professional responsibilities with the love and attention he gave to those closest to him.
Charles had a passion for fishing, which brought him joy and peace throughout his life. It was a cherished hobby where he found solace and spent time enjoying the great outdoors.
He leaves behind his beloved wife of 28 years, Shirley Hadden, who was his steadfast partner in life. Charles is also survived by and his daughters, Tonya Pridgeon and Kaitlyn Hadden, his son, Shannon Murphy. He was a loving brother to Jimmy Hadden, Clara McCraney and Jeanette Laub, and he will be missed deeply by his many grandchildren.
Family and friends are invited to celebrate Charles's life at the visitation on October 2, 2025, from 1:00 PM to 2:00 PM at Adams Funeral Home Chapel, in Blountstown. The funeral service will follow at 2:00 PM also at the funeral home.
Charles Hadden will be remembered for his unwavering devotion to his family, his strong work ethic, and the love he shared with all who had the privilege of knowing him. His legacy of kindness and care will remain in the hearts of those he touched.
